Assistant SENDCo - Job Description
We are seeking a committed and enthusiastic Assistant SENDCo to join a dedicated team at a vibrant school. This is an exciting opportunity for a passionate professional to support the provision for pupils with special educational needs and disabilities, working alongside an experienced SENDCo and leadership team. The position begins in September 2025.
Responsibilities of the Assistant SENDCo:
1. Support the SENDCo in managing the day-to-day operation of SEND provision across the school.
2. Collaborate with staff, pupils, and families to ensure children with additional needs are fully supported to reach their potential.
3. Assist in the identification, assessment, and monitoring of pupils with SEND.
4. Support the development, review, and implementation of EHCPs, Individual Support Plans, and personalized interventions.
5. Help organize and deliver training and support for staff regarding inclusive teaching strategies.
6. Liaise with external agencies and professionals as appropriate.
7. Promote a culture of high expectations, inclusion, and achievement for all pupils.
8. Hold QTS and have experience working with pupils with SEND.
9. Be passionate about inclusive education and improving outcomes for all learners.
10. Possess excellent communication, interpersonal, and organizational skills.
11. Work collaboratively with staff, families, and external agencies.
12. Understand current SEND legislation, the Code of Practice, and inclusive classroom strategies.
13. (Desirable) Have completed, be working towards, or be willing to undertake the National Award for SEN Coordination (NASENCO).
